Computerised tomography or computerised axial tomography called as CT scan is the modern imaging procedure that provides accurate captures of the two-dimensional scans of the particular section of the body.

CT scan is becoming the leading technology for providing detailed information about various body parts using a combination of x-rays. Contrary to the conventional x-rays, CT scans provide more accurate results of organs, bones, and tissues which seemed a complicated task in former technology.

If you are skeptical about why you need a CT scan, here’s how CT scans have helped the physicians to revolutionise the diagnosis process and get the benefits of leveraging modern technology to deliver efficient diagnostic results.
  • To invest recent accidents or injuries
  • Accidents often lead to serious internal injuries, and for those usually, CT scans are recommended to examine the severity of the damage. Regular x-rays alone cannot do the needful, which makes the CT scans centre the first resort for imaging procedures concerning an emergency event.
  • Examining blood vessels
    CT scans are the optimal solutions for the evaluation and examination of blood vessels to check for blockages or any other potential prevailing problem. The information generated by the imaging procedure helps your doctor to validate the issue you are facing or reinforce a diagnosis for prevailing vascular disease without having to perform invasive surgeries or biopsies.
  • Investigating tumours
  • CT scan centre in chandigarh  is the first considerate step when it comes to diagnosis or treatment procedure for someone housing a tumour. CT scan helps your doctor to get detailed information about the size and location of the tumour and perform the biopsies accurately. The imaging procedure has, by far proven the best technology to analyse how involved is the tumour with the surrounding tissue.
  • Examining head and brain injuries
  • CT scans help doctors in getting comprehensive information about the severity of injuries that cause damage to a person’s brain and head. Evaluation of injuries, headache, dizziness, stroke, and tumours have all become accessible with CT scans with increased accuracy. The imaging procedure is far better and beneficial as compared to the conventional techniques to scan the brain and head injuries.
